How speeding accidents often occur

Traveling at high speeds makes it difficult to stop in time when needed, which can result in dangerous head-on or rear-end collisions, accidents at intersections and crashes involving pedestrians and bicyclists. When people speed while under the influence of alcohol or drugs or while texting or otherwise driving while distracted, it compounds an already hazardous situation. The impact from a vehicle going at excessive speeds can cause catastrophic injuries. An accident can quickly turn deadly when a truck is involved. Common injuries from speeding accidents

Severe and catastrophic injuries are not unusual in speeding accidents. Injuries such as the following can result:

  • Traumatic brain injuries
  • Spinal cord damage that causes paralysis
  • Neck injuries and whiplash
  • Concussions
  • Broken bones and fractures
  • Soft tissue injuries

Long-term effects typical after a speeding accident

In addition to the initial emergency care, surgeries and other medical treatments that people often need after speeding accidents, they may require long-lasting and often expensive on-going care. Victims with severe injuries may need:

  • Extensive physical therapy and rehabilitation
  • Therapy for psychological trauma
  • Pricey medications for chronic pain management
  • Prolonged nursing care
  • Assistance with the basic tasks of life, including eating, bathing and dressing
  • Assistive devices and equipment

Calculating compensation for speeding accident cases

The compensation we pursue for you will be calculated based on your injuries, damages and related factors. We will pursue economic damages such as payment of medical bills and lost wages, as well as non-economic damages that reimburse you for your pain and suffering and the emotional turmoil from the crash. Motor vehicle crash cases can often be settled out of court through negotiations with the at-fault driver’s insurance company. The benefit to a fair out-of-court settlement offer is that you are assured compensation for your accident and settlements often resolve more quickly. A downside is that you may not get as much money as you would in a trial verdict—however, there is no guarantee that a trial will go in your favor.
